  • Abstract
    A time-dependent one-dimensional analytic model is presented describing the dynamics of a plasma and a magnetic field in relative motion to each other. It is found that the interface between the plasma and field deteriorates in a way that is analogous to the Rayleigh-Taylor instability for a plasma in equilibrium. The growth rate of the perturbations is identical to the classical Rayleigh-Taylor (kg)¿ scaling, except that the gravity g is not a constant, but is proportional to the magnetic field strength and the square root of the plasma velocity. Applications to space physics and astrophysical phenomena are presented.
